Cool demo of a touch screen in a taxi in Shanghai, China. This company has revenues of hundreds of millions of dollars. The VC is one of the most famous in China. Gary Rieschel of qimingventures.com. Gary was the founder of SOFTBANK Venture Capital/Mobius Venture Capital in the U.S. (1996), a firm with over $2 billion USD under management, and served on Softbank’s Global Board of Directors. - Robert Scoble
17% of recent Christina Aguilera concert tickets were sold through this system, which shows how good it is. Competes with several other taxi systems, but shows much more interactivity than other systems. - Robert Scoble

If you are buying a laptop in the next few days I probably saw your hard drive being made today at Seagate's factory in Wuxi. Wow, what a tour we had.
Can anyone guess how many hard drives they make every week? It's an astounding number. They told us that we were first US bloggers to tour the fab where they make 2.5-inch drives for laptops and automobiles. - Robert Scoble
